Transaction 69999e61fbe0895df51eca592910617205b9a8d0ce91d4c07f21bc8b65e853e2
1 Input
1 Output
-
69999e61fbe0895df51eca592910617205b9a8d0ce91d4c07f21bc8b65e853e2:0
- value
- 10900
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ad67fda71193c6c2ba826e0abadd23e5056357e
- address
- bc1q8tt8lkn3ry7xc2agyms2htwj8eg9vdt7f2g5nz